> Methods are classified using the following rules:
>
> 1. known prefixes (initialize.* => initialize-reseleas, test.* -> testing..)
could we have initialize and not initialize-release
> 2. getters and setters of instance variables
> 3. know protocols of super implementors
> 4. gather all implementors in the system and choose the most used protocol.
>
> I guess that will cover most stuff, of course known prefixes will have to be
> extended...

>> Categories they are "integrated documentation" and, the fact that some
>> methods remain 'as yet unclassified' IS meaningful -- it indicates
>> that the class is either private or single-purpose. There are a lot
>> of "code elements" in the system (classes, methods, categories,
>> packages, etc.) and so sometimes, as you said, classes are simple
>> enough that additional category elements are not needed.
>>
>> Categories are the domain of humans, not machines. They're for the
>> writer to communicate to the readers. Auto-categorization does not
>> increase the effectiveness of categories -- in fact I think it would
>> dilute it.
